Stretch your legs and take in the spectacular views of Isle del Sol

From Copacabana to the Island of the Sun☀ Booked the boat the day before (35Bs one way) - There are many signs saying Isle del Sol on the main street. We wanted to relax and had booked a hotel on the island, so we only booked one way. There are two boarding and disembarking points, the north and south sides of the island. We said we would go to the north side and return to the south the next day, but we were told that we could not purchase a round trip ticket and that we would have to buy the return ticket locally. On the day We had booked a 9am boat and headed to the designated location. The boat departed about 5 minutes late. The first half was fine with no waves, but the area around the south side of the island was quite shaky. I took motion sickness medicine just in case, which was a relief. I recommend motion sickness medicine. Arrived on the north side of the island It took about 2 hours to get to the north side When we were about to walk, there was a line from the pier to the boat. I wondered what was going on, but it was a fee to use the north side of the island (15Bs). If you don't pay, you won't be allowed to land. We ended up starting to walk just before noon (11:45am). Trekking Not only was the view of the lake amazing, but along the way, we saw pigs sunbathing, donkeys, burros, sheep, cats, dogs and many other animals running about freely. The dogs were very docile. There are also 70 large and small ruins on the island. Your ticket will be checked several times along the way, so don't lose it. The altitude is nearly 4000m, so don't push yourself, take a deep breath and walk slowly. There are kiosks along the way where you can buy drinks and fruit, but the items are limited. When you are stopped again halfway, you will be charged for the south side of the island (15Bs). I didn't understand at first because I went there without knowing, but it seems that the fee is charged separately for the north and south. There are ticket checking points here and there, and if you don't have a ticket, you will be stopped and forced to buy one. If you walk a little way into the south side, you will find several restaurants. Many shops are closed during the off-season and have limited hours, so if they are open, you should go. The price is twice as much as Copacabana, but it's worth it because you can enjoy the spectacular view. The view of the 6,000m-class mountains seen from the island in the evening is also spectacular. We booked a hotel where you can see the sunrise. This island is really relaxing, and time flows slowly. There are no cars on the island and the air is clean. You can come here as a day trip from Copacabana, but it's a waste. I recommend taking your time and enjoying the beautiful scenery. What to bring: Essential Hat Sunscreen Water Boat reservation ticket Recommended Snacks, light meals, fruit #islandofthesun #copacabana #isledelsole
